When examining SF24 series diesel engines, the power output reveals an interesting 23.5-24HP sweet spot that makes these workhorses particularly versatile. The base model converts 17.3kW of mechanical energy at 2,200 RPM into practical power for agricultural applications, though actual performance can vary like different blade configurations on a Swiss Army knife.
Imagine trying to power a village's worth of rice harvesters - that's where the SF24's flexibility shines. The 24HP models particularly excel at balancing fuel efficiency with torque requirements for medium-duty tasks.
For operations in Northeast China's -30°C winters, the Jiangsu Changxing variant brings smart adaptations. Its oil pan heating system acts like an electric blanket for engine components, solving the cold-start puzzle that plagues standard diesels. This 2,400 RMB base model (2,900 RMB with electric start) demonstrates how regional customization drives diesel engine evolution.

The SF24's 123×45mm crankshaft dimensions work in concert with X6 aluminum alloy frames to create what engineers call "the dancing elephant effect" - surprising agility in robust machinery. This material science breakthrough from Central South University collaboration achieves a 15% weight reduction without compromising structural integrity.
Recent field studies in Shandong Province showed SF24-powered transporters achieving 8% better fuel economy compared to equivalent 25HP models when hauling 1.5-ton loads over mixed terrain.
